I was just approved for disability for Lyme Disease.

I had been turned down initially and with appealing it.

My lawyer had just called and told me that since my Lyme Doc refused to write a letter, she did not know that she could win the case since the symptoms are so subjective.

Social Security has a new pilot program to review cases that are up for the Hearing stage. It was this pilot program review of my case that got it approved!

I had TONS of documentation from the beginning.

I used the guidelines on this site for my appeal. My appeal was 25 pages long of typed info!

I see this as a HUGE step forward for the Social Security Disability opinion on Lyme Disease being disabling!

Best of luck to everyone and hang in there! It took 1 1/2 years for me.
